Ticket: FIELD-2281 — Expired credentials blocking offline sync

For the weekly sync: the Heronpath field-survey app's offline mode stopped reconciling on Monday because the cached sync token expired while crews were out of coverage. Surveys queued locally are intact, but uploads fail silently until re-auth. We've extended token lifetime to 30 days and reissued credentials. The replacement key for the internal sync service follows.

service key, fafog-fahaf: vxb3-x55

## Runbook: Clock skew between build agents

Symptom: Quillbarrow pipeline artifacts appear "from the future" or cache lookups miss. Check agent drift with the skew probe; anything over 2s is actionable. Restart the time sync daemon on the affected agent, then invalidate its local cache. If drift recurs within an hour, cordon the agent and page infra. Confirm the fix by rebuilding the canary and checking the token below.

pipeline stamp: htk9_6ce9d33c5

Subject: Handover — Pellwright hermetic build migration

Hi Dorna,

Handing off the Pellwright migration to the Glasskiln hermetic build system. Phase one is done: all network fetches are pinned and the toolchain is vendored. Remaining work is swapping the release pipeline to the sealed builder image and retiring the legacy runner. The sealed builder verifies releases against the deploy key below.

signing key of hahog-kagug = bky3_vdF

- [ ] **Step 7: Breaker override escrow.** After sealing the signing keys for the Tallgrove upstream API circuit breaker, confirm the support team can force the breaker open during a full outage. The override bundle lives in the sealed escrow drawer and is useless without its unlock phrase. Two ceremony witnesses must initial this step before proceeding. The escrow bundle is decrypted with the recovery passphrase that follows.

vault phrase of kahip-kahop = holath-quenmir

// Blue-green deploys for the Tollgate billing worker run on a fixed cadence:
// the green pool drains invoices while blue picks up new webhook events.
// Plugin authors should assume their hooks may fire twice during cutover,
// so make handlers idempotent. The client below targets whichever pool is
// active; the Ledgerline router handles the swap transparently, and you
// never need to know which color you hit. Initialize the client with the
// key that follows.

API key for yahig-tadup: kto7_ubizbYm